@@ -121,6 +121,16 @@ export class Searchbar implements ComponentInterface {
*/
@Prop() showCancelButton: 'never' | 'focus' | 'always' = 'never';
/**
* Sets the behavior for the clear button. Defaults to `"focus"`.
* Setting to `"focus"` shows the clear button on focus if the
* input is not empty.
* Setting to `"never"` hides the clear button.
* Setting to `"always"` shows the clear button regardless
* of focus state, but only if the input is not empty.
*/
@Prop() showClearButton: 'never' | 'focus' | 'always' = 'focus';
/**
* If `true`, enable spellcheck on the input.
*/

@@ -419,6 +439,20 @@ export class Searchbar implements ComponentInterface {
return true;
}
/**
* Determines whether or not the clear button should be visible onscreen.
* Clear button should be shown if one of two conditions applies:
* 1. `showClearButton` is set to `always`.
* 2. `showClearButton` is set to `focus`, and the searchbar has been focused.
*/
private shouldShowClearButton(): boolean {
if ((this.showClearButton === 'never') || (this.showClearButton === 'focus' && !this.focused)) {
return false;
}
return true;
}
